What you will be doing:
- Coordinate, plan and schedule linehaul & metro dispatch with sharp attention to detail
- Build load out plans with clear loading details to maximise efficiency
- Develop and maintain strong, positive relationships with carrier partners and sub contract carriers
-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) such as truck utilization and DIFOT to drive results
- Work closely with warehouse and transport teams to ensure seamless operations
- Operate transport and warehouse management systems (TMS/WMS) to track and optimize deliveries
- Quickly respond to challenges and adapt plans to keep everything on track
